Sharjah was defeated with a heavy result. Shabab Al-Ahly takes the lead in the league with the red line

The Shabab Al-Ahly team pushed its competitor, Al-Sharjah, away from the competition for the Professional Football League title, after defeating it 4-1 today, Thursday, at Sharjah Stadium, in the presence of more than 4,000 spectators, as part of the 15th round of the competition.
With this victory, the “Dubai Knights” strengthened their lead in the standings with 38 points, continuing to consolidate their superiority at the top, while Sharjah’s balance froze at 17 points, effectively removing the “King” from the race to compete for the league title as the tournament entered an advanced stage.
The match witnessed a strong start from the guests, as Bruno Lemos opened the scoring early for Shabab Al-Ahly in the 6th minute, before Sharjah succeeded in equalizing through Firas Belarabi in the 42nd minute. The most prominent turning point was in the last minute of the first half, when the referee showed the direct red card in the face of Igor Kornado, allowing Sharjah to complete the match with a reduced number, which clearly affected its technical and mental balance.
Shabab Al-Ahly took advantage of the numerical deficiency in the best way, quickly regaining the lead in the 50th minute through Yahya Al-Ghassani, before Saeed Ezzat Allah increased the score with the third goal in the 65th minute, amid a clear decline in the ability of the hosts to keep up with the match pattern.
With Sharjah’s late push and attempts to reduce the gap, Shabab Al-Ahly took advantage of the spaces, and Joao Marcelo concluded the goal festival by scoring the fourth goal in the 87th minute, confirming the superiority of the “Dubai Knights” and bringing the curtain down on a difficult night for the “King” fans.
